According to the Korea Coast Guard on Monday, the latest 50-tonnage crime prevention patrol ship(P-117) has been deployed at the port of Sokcho Coast Guard Station. The P-117 is going to carry out various missions at sea and replace the mission of the 25 tonnage class patrol ship that was suspended in january last year.
In order to help revive the local economy, such as domestic shipbuilding-related companies that suffer from decreased ship orders and restructuring, KCG contracted Korean shipbuilding companies and carried out the construction work.
With a length of 28.7 meters and a width of 5.4 meters, the P-117, equipped with two main engines and two water jets, has a maximum speed of 29 knots, allowing high-speed operation. The P-117 is scheduled to go through commissioning training before being put into full-scale maritime security missions in April.
